Welcome to April's Dakka (unofficial) Monthly Painting Challenge. For those who aren't familliar, this is a no-prize-related challenge open to any and all painters and hobbyists. Anyone can enter, from a newcomer to the hobby with your first box of minis to a multiple-time Golden Demon champion, and the winner each month will be decided by community poll, not just on the paintwork but on the effort, creativity and awesomeness of the finished piece!
For this month, the theme is: Veteran
Your entry should be a miniature/miniatures that are distinguishable as Veterans in their respective settings. These can be from any game, manufacturer or setting, and can, and may be converted as much as you like. To give you an idea of the scope this can cover, all the examples below would be perfectly elligible for entry:
- Any model with the word 'Veteran' in its name or rank
- A model wearing or receiving honours, medals or the like
- A model that is weathered to reflect an extended conflict
- A model with some kind of wound, trophy or item from a previous battle
As this theme can cover many things, you may submit up to 4 lines of background if you wish, to lend context to your choice of mini. This will be displayed alongside the images in the voting thread.
How To Enter - You may enter up to 5 MODELS as a SINGLE ENTRY, and are permitted one entry per member per month. If you enter multiple models, they should ideally be related in some way, such as part of the same squad, unit or scene if you are doing a diorama
- You MUST post a 'proof' picture of your entry in the thread of the state it was in before you started working on it. This could be unassembled, primed or even basecoated, so long as we can see where you are starting from. Entries that do not submit a Proof Picture will not be elligible for voting.
- After this, you may post WIP pictures in this thread and your own if you wish, and on completing the entry, you may post up to 4 final pictures IN THIS THREAD that will then be used for voting. If you do not finish in time, the single most recent WIP picture may be submitted.

How Long Do I Have? This challenge begins Wednesday 1st April and will end at midnight GMT on the 30th April. After this, I shall compile the finished entries into a new thread, and voting will run for 5 days.
Voting Guidelines
When voting, consider the following as well as the quality of the paintwork:
- The creativity and originality of the entry
- The overall composition of the piece, such as basing, conversion and coherency between the models
- The relevance of the entry to the theme
- The effort the painter has put into the entry

Sorry, today is not a very witty day. I’ll try to think of something pithy next time you mutate.
The PC is from the venerable dreadnought kit. I did kitbash a MM arm, which might show up in this competition, time allowing.
Both the basic and the Ven dread kits come with AsCs, TLLCs, and powerfists. The ven kit gives you the PC, while the regular kit gets you the ML arm. If you want the other options you need to either kitbash or look elsewhere.
